A Senior Research Assistant, often referred to as 'Viši asistent' in Serbian academic contexts, is a pivotal role in higher education research teams. This position represents an advanced step beyond entry-level research assistance, where professionals take on greater responsibility in executing and contributing to scholarly projects. The meaning of Senior Research Assistant encompasses supporting principal investigators with complex tasks like experimental design, data interpretation, and manuscript preparation. In Serbia, this role has evolved within the framework of the Bologna Process (adopted in 2005), aligning with European standards for academic mobility and research quality.
Historically, such positions emerged in the post-World War II expansion of universities, gaining prominence in Serbia during the 1990s reforms amid economic transitions. Today, Senior Research Assistants drive innovation at institutions like the University of Belgrade and University of Novi Sad, contributing to fields from natural sciences to humanities.
Senior Research Assistants in Serbia handle multifaceted duties that blend hands-on research with administrative support. They design and conduct experiments or surveys, analyze large datasets using tools like MATLAB or NVivo, and co-author peer-reviewed papers. Supervision of junior staff and students is common, fostering team collaboration on grant-funded initiatives.
These responsibilities ensure projects meet rigorous academic standards, often under tight deadlines tied to EU Horizon programs.
To secure Senior Research Assistant jobs in Serbia, candidates need a solid academic foundation. Required academic qualifications typically include a Master's degree (Magistar) in a relevant field, with a PhD strongly preferred for competitive roles. Research focus or expertise should align with the department, such as biotechnology at the Faculty of Biology or economics at the Faculty of Economics.

Serbia's higher education system, comprising over 120 institutions, offers growing opportunities for Senior Research Assistants amid national R&D investments reaching 1% of GDP by 2023. Key employers include public universities funded by the Ministry of Education, Science and Technological Development, with roles often project-based via competitive tenders.
The job market is competitive yet promising, with demand in STEM driven by EU integration. Salaries average 80,000-110,000 RSD monthly (roughly 670-920 EUR), supplemented by project allowances. Recent trends show increased focus on sustainable development and digital transformation, as highlighted in higher education discussions.
Cultural context emphasizes collaboration and publication impact, with positions advertised through university portals and platforms like AcademicJobs.com.

Bologna Process: A European higher education reform initiative standardizing degrees and promoting research excellence, implemented in Serbia since 2005.
Viši asistent: The Serbian term for Senior Research Assistant, denoting a mid-level research position requiring advanced expertise.
Scopus-indexed journals: Peer-reviewed publications tracked by Elsevier's Scopus database, a key metric for academic impact in Serbia.
